Medical Assistant - Pediatric Dermatology
A Medical Assistant provides quality patient care by assisting the physician with clinic specific tasks, including rooming, vitals, injections, and point of care testing and treatment. The Medical Assistant follows Madison Medical specific standards of practice, policies and procedures. This specific position reports to the Regional Director and Clinic Supervisor and is located in Glendale (2.5 days) and Waukesha (2 days) per week. 

What You'll Do:

  • Escort patients to exam room, complete a brief history and obtain vital signs if needed.
  • Perform local anesthesia prior to skin procedures.
  • Perform skin procedures such as skin tag removal, photodynamic therapy and others.
  • Perform phototherapy treatment on patients, under the direction of dermatologist.
  • Assist dermatologist with skin procedures/surgeries such as biopsies and skin cancer removals.
  • Assist dermatologist with cosmetic procedures that include Botox, chemical peels and laser treatment.
  • Stay current with electronic health record changes and document patient information in the electronic health record.
  • Keeps up with the flow of operational needs to ensure the best and timely care for patients – manages phone calls and messages efficiently, checks EHR and email regularly, handles prior authorizations and refills, and effectively triages phone calls.
  • Organize and prepare exam rooms for patient care. 
  • Provide patient education and counsel patients regarding their diagnosis and treatment.
  • Manage incoming phone calls, prior authorizations, medication refills and communicate biopsy and test results to patients. 
  • Schedule appointments as needed.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
